Design and Fabrication of Electromagnetic Embossing Machine

Abstract


Conventionally, in many manufacturing industries, embossing operation is carried out manually using jigs and fixtures or by means of a machine. These machines are mechanical, pneumatic or hydraulic. The running cost of these types of machines is also high. An electromagnetic embossing machine proves itself better against these machines in respect with above said points. In this machine, embossing operation is carried out in project work on very thin aluminium sheet or other soft materials. In this machine, there is an electromagnet which incorporates a plunger passing through it. The plunger is allowed for vertical motion through electromagnet. The plunger carries an iron core fixed to its upper end, and to the lower end of the same a tool holder is attached, this tool holder holds an embossing tool that is used for embossing. The plunger is hanged with the help of springs. A working material is placed just below the embossing tool. The entire assembly is fixed into some kind of housing or body.
